Business and Financial Project Management Professionals vs Teaching and other educational professionals Salary (2025)

How do Business and Financial Project Management Professionals and Teaching and other educational professionals salaries compare in the UK? Here is a detailed side-by-side breakdown.

Business and Financial Project Management Professionals earns £12,617 more per year (28% higher)
vs

Detailed Comparison

MetricBusiness and Financial Project Management ProfessionalsTeaching and other educational professionalsDifference
Median Annual£57,450£44,833+£12,617
Mean Annual£61,338£44,838+£16,500
Monthly£4,788£3,736+£1,052
Weekly£1,105£862+£243
Hourly£27.62£21.55+£6.07

Salary Range Comparison

PercentileBusiness and Financial Project Management ProfessionalsTeaching and other educational professionals
10th (Entry)£31,840£18,367
25th£44,478£31,652
50th (Median)£57,450£44,833
75th£75,604£55,749
90th (Senior)£93,658£70,046
